Your business is growing and it’s now time to add more employees. The expense involved in hiring the wrong person, especially at a senior level, can be large. Hiring the right talent should not be an intimidating process. 

A key element is the defining the skills, attributes and traits that the ideal applicant should have.

It is important that the position description for the job be well understood and documented. It should contain responsibilities, duties and specific objectives of the position, not the person. Know what you’re looking for, before you start looking.

The interview itself should be structured in a way that brings out all the key traits and attributes of the candidate. It should also provide an opportunity for the candidate to gain the information they need to make their employment decision. 

Consider having the candidate interview with several members of your team. They have a good feel for the culture of your company, and you will have several additional internal opinions to help the decision process.
